2012 TAAT Annual Conference

Integrating Assistive Technology
to meet the new Common Core standards for Special Education 

 

Embassy Suites Hotel and Convention

Center - Murfreesboro, TN

 

 Pre-Conference Sessions

November 28, 2012

Full Conference November 29 - 30, 2012

ACCOMMODATIONS

A block of rooms (single or double) is available until November 2nd, 2012 at the Embassy Suites. A full breakfast is included for those staying at the Embassy Suites. Rates are $124 per night single to quad occupancy plus local taxes and motel fee. The state tax of 9.25% will be waived if rooms are paid for by an agency or school system. You must provide your school's tax exempt form or ID number when making payment to omit state tax. You may call the hotel directly at (615) 890-4464 to reserve your room under the "Assistive Technology Conference" block.
